SSブログ

Windows PEのカスタマイズ(PE3.1応用編1) [Windows PE]

最終更新日:2015/04/15

前提条件:基本編を読んでいる事を前提に書いてあります。
http://urawaza-manual.blog.so-net.ne.jp/2015-04-14-3

処理内容の説明及び注意事項
32Bit版の場合
「C:\PE31_32」
「C:\Program Files\Windows AIK\Tools\PETools\x86\WinPE_FPs」
「C:\Program Files\Windows AIK\Tools\PETools\x86\WinPE_FPs\ja-jp」
64Bit版の場合
「C:\PE31_64」
「C:\Program Files\Windows AIK\Tools\PETools\amd64\WinPE_FPs」
「C:\Program Files\Windows AIK\Tools\PETools\amd64\WinPE_FPs\ja-jp」
32Bit版と64Bit版で異なる点はこの3か所だけです。 64Bit版の作業を行う際は、お手数ですが、この3か所を置換してください。

基本編ではここから
copype x86 C:\PE31_32
copy winpe.wim boot.wim
dism /mount-wim /wimfile:C:\PE31_32\boot.wim /index:1 /mountdir:C:\PE31_32\mount
dism /image:C:\PE31_32\mount /add-package /packagepath:"C:\Program Files\Windows AIK\Tools\PETools\x86\WINPE_FPS\WINPE-FONTSUPPORT-JA-JP.CAB"
dism /image:C:\PE31_32\mount /add-package /packagepath:"C:\Program Files\Windows AIK\Tools\PETools\x86\WINPE_FPS\JA-JP\LP_JA-JP.CAB"
※設定変更等 dism /Unmount-Wim /MountDir:C:\PE31_32\mount /Commit
dism /Unmount-Wim /MountDir:C:\PE31_32\mount /Discard
ここまでの設定変更等を省いた部分を説明しました。

ここからは設定変更について説明します。

適用済みパッケージの確認方法
dism /image:C:\PE31_32\mount /get-packages
※状態で「インストールの保留中」と表示されますが、正常です。

パッケージの削除方法
例:dism /image:C:\PE31_32\mount /remove-package /packagepath:"C:\Program Files\Windows AIK\Tools\PETools\x86\WINPE_FPS\JA-JP\LP_JA-JP.CAB"
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/remove-package このコマンドで変更します。
/packagepath:"C:\Program Files\Windows AIK\Tools\PETools\x86\WINPE_FPS\JA-JP\LP_JA-JP.CAB" 削除したいパッケージのパスを:以降に指定します。

・スクラッチ領域(RAMドライブのサイズ)の変更方法
例:dism /image:C:\PE31_32\mount /Set-Scratchspace:512
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-Scratchspace このコマンドで値を変更します。
:512 変更したいサイズを:以降に指定します。ここでは最大値512MBを指定しています。
補足
初期値は32MBです。
設定可能な値は32/64/128/256/512
通常は初期値か128MBまで程度で十分です。
確認方法
dism /image:C:\PE31_32\mount /Get-Scratchspace

ターゲットパスの設定
例:dism /image:C:\PE31_32\mount /Set-TargetPath:X:\
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-TargetPath このコマンドで変更します。
:X:\ ターゲットパスを:以降に指定します。
補足
ターゲット パスを設定する場合は、次の制約に注意してください。
• パスは 3 文字以上 32 文字以下で指定する必要があります。
• パスの先頭は文字 (C ~ Z までの任意の文字) にする必要があります。
• ドライブ文字の後に ":\" を指定する必要があります。
• パスのその他の部分に、Unicode 文字などの無効な文字を含めることはできません。
• パスは絶対パスで指定する必要があり、"." や ".." などの要素は使用できません。
• パスに空白や "\\" を含めることはできません。
確認方法
dism /image:C:\PE31_32\mount /Get-TargetPath

設定の一覧を表示
dism /image:C:\PE31_32\mount /Get-PESettings
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Get-PESettings このコマンドで変更します。

キーボード ドライバーの設定方法
例:dism /image:C:\PE31_32\mount /Set-LayeredDriver:1
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-LayeredDriver このコマンドで変更します。
:1 キーボードドライバーを:以降に指定します。この場合101/102キータイプ
補足
規定値は6です。
1 から 6 の値を指定できます。
1.PC/AT 拡張キーボード (101/102 キー)
2.韓国語 PC/AT 101 キー互換キーボード/MS Natural Keyboard (Type 1)
3.韓国語 PC/AT 101 キー互換キーボード/MS Natural Keyboard (Type 2)
4.韓国語 PC/AT 101 キー互換キーボード/MS Natural Keyboard (Type 3)
5.韓国語キーボード (103/106 キー)
6.日本語キーボード (106/109 キー)

既定のシステム ユーザー インターフェイス の言語設定
Dism /image:C:\PE31_32\mount /Set-UILang:ja-JP
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-UILang このコマンドで変更します。
:ja-JP 言語を:以降に指定します。この場合日本語
補足
指定した言語が Windows イメージにインストールされていない場合、このコマンドは失敗します。

システム ロケールの言語設定
Dism /image:C:\PE31_32\mount /Set-SysLocale:ja-JP
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-SysLocale このコマンドで変更します。
:ja-JP 言語を:以降に指定します。この場合日本語

ユーザー ロケールの言語設定
Dism /image:C:\PE31_32\mount /Set-UserLocale:ja-JP
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-UserLocale このコマンドで変更します。
:ja-JP 言語を:以降に指定します。この場合日本語

まとめて言語設定
Dism /image:C:\PE31_32\mount /Set-AllIntl:ja-JP
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-AllIntl このコマンドで変更します。
:ja-JP 言語を:以降に指定します。この場合日本語

Windows イメージの既定タイム ゾーン設定
Dism /image:C:\PE31_32\mount /Set-TimeZone:"Tokyo Standard Time"
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Set-TimeZone このコマンドで変更します。
:"Tokyo Standard Time" タイムゾーンを:以降に指定します。この場合日本の東京
補足
タイム ゾーンの名前は、レジストリの H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\TimeZones\ のタイム ゾーン設定の名前と正確に一致する必要があります。

地域と言語の設定に関する基本情報を表示
Dism /image:C:\PE31_32\mount /Get-Intl
説明
dism /image: ここで設定するイメージの場所を指定します。
C:\PE31_32\mount これがイメージの場所
/Get-Intl このコマンドで表示します。

ドライバーの追加
長くなったのでPE3.1応用編2で説明します。
http://urawaza-manual.blog.so-net.ne.jp/2015-04-20t
タグ:Windows PE
nice!(0)  コメント(0)  トラックバック(0) 
共通テーマ:パソコン・インターネット

nice! 0

コメント 0

コメントを書く

お名前:
URL:
コメント:
画像認証:
下の画像に表示されている文字を入力してください。

トラックバック 0

この広告は前回の更新から一定期間経過したブログに表示されています。更新すると自動で解除されます。